What is Guest Posting in SEO


What is Guest Posting in SEO and How Can It Improve Your Website Traffic

Guest blogging, guest posting, or submitting guest posts can enhance your search engine optimization (SEO) efforts. It can also improve your website traffic.

But, a concern is that you must be careful with this practice. You may do more harm than good if you submit guest posts without a strategy.

The solution?

Design a guest blogging strategy!

If you follow the tips in the article, you’ll learn why is guest blogging so effective for improving your site's organic traffic.

What Does Guest Post Mean?

Guest blogging in SEO is when a content creator writes and publishes an article on someone else's website.

Here is an example of a guest post:

It usually begins with the words "Guest post written by" or similar and contains the author's bio.

The example above shows the bio before the article. In most cases, however, you can find the guest blogger's author bio after the article.

Many bloggers and website owners are open to hosting guest posts from industry experts. And they may want to share these opportunities with you if you reach out to them.

Email platform GetResponse has a page on their site asking blog contributions:

You can also search for guest posting opportunities on social media platforms (like LinkedIn, Twitter, and Facebook). Or, you can use a service or tool that connects bloggers and website owners with writers looking for guest post opportunities.

Why Is Guest Posting Important for SEO?

Guest blogging requires tons of investment on your end.

So, if you're wondering if guest posting is worth every penny regarding SEO, the answer is a resounding "YES!"

It can help you get exposure to a new audience. As a result, it can reel in more traffic to your website.

Here are more benefits of guest blogging in SEO:

Helps Build Backlinks for Improving Search Engine Ranking

A backlink is a link from one website to another.

If a website has a lot of high-quality backlinks, search engines like Google see this as a sign the website is a good resource. As a result, they will often rank it higher in search results.

Note that the quality of the backlinks is often more important than the quantity. It's better to have a few high-quality backlinks from reputable websites than many low-quality backlinks from spammy or untrustworthy websites.

So for backlinks to work in favor of your own blog, be selective with the websites you contact.

Below are tips on how you can do that.

* Look for sites relevant to your business or industry - Backlinks from related websites will be more valuable and carry more weight than links from unrelated sites. After all, search engines view links from relevant sites as a sign that your site is also relevant and valuable.

* Check the authority of the site - Authority is a measure of the trustworthiness and credibility of a website. You can use tools like Ahrefs or Moz's Domain Authority (DA) metric to check site authority. The higher it is, the more valuable the link will be.

* Look for sites with high organic traffic - The more traffic a site gets, the more likely a potential customer will see your link. You can use tools like SimilarWeb to check the traffic.

Demonstrates Your Expertise in Your Industry

Nowadays, there’s a concept called E-E-A-T. It stands for Experience, Expertise, Authoritativeness, and Trustworthiness.

While E-E-A-T is not a ranking factor, it helps readers set themselves apart from their competitors by showcasing their extensive knowledge about the topic.

Of many things, E-E-A-T content demonstrates and strengthens your credibility as a writer. It magnetizes your target audience.    

For example, there’s the guest post submitted above by Brian Dean — an authority in blogging and SEO.

People (who want to learn more about blogging and SEO) would gravitate toward a guest article by Brian Dean. They’ll prefer posts from him more than the ones from his competitors because of his superior knowledge about both topics.

Below are ways to demonstrate your expertise in your industry.

* Write a steady stream of content - Submit articles or blog posts about your field and share them on your website or industry-specific websites or publications.

* Give presentations at industry conferences - Share your expertise on social media platforms by posting relevant content and engaging with others in your industry.

* Publish research or case studies in your field - Collaborate with others. It can be a great way to showcase your knowledge and contribute to the body of knowledge in your industry.

Attracts Higher-Quality Traffic

The links you'll build on your guest post? Readers may also click on them.

And if they click on them, it indicates these people like the post content.

You can call this "referral traffic."

Referral traffic is traffic or the visitors that arrive at a website by clicking on a link on another website.

For example, if you have a link to your website on your social media profile or on a blog that you wrote, and someone clicks on that link to visit your website, that person would be counted as referral traffic in your website's analytics.

Below are the best ways to earn referral traffic with guest posts.

* Provide significant value - Write a great guest post that provides value to the reader and encourages them to visit your website for more information or to see related content.

* Use social media networks - Share your guest post on social media and other platforms to drive traffic to your website.  

* Socialize - Engage with the audience of the host website. It can help build your reputation and encourage readers to visit your website.

How to Do Guest Posting Effectively?

It’s inarguable that you can elevate your brand if you start to write guest posts. But, it’s a double-edged sword. If you do it without caution, it can also come with negative effects.

Below are ways to submit guest posts effectively.

Find the Right Blogs and Websites to Guest Post On

Determine what you want to accomplish as a guest author. From there, form decisions based on your goals. For example, choose websites that align with your personal brand. Also, go with those that can bring value to your business.

Below are more (in addition to the tips discussed earlier) ways to find the right guest post opportunities.

* Use Google - One of the easiest ways to find guest post opportunities is Google — search for websites accepting guest posts. Use advanced search operators and keywords related to your niche and add terms like "submit a guest post" or "write for us" to your search query.

* Join a guest blogging community - Many online communities connect bloggers and blog owners that look for and accept guest posts. Joining one of these communities can be a great way to find guest post opportunities. You can also know and mingle with other bloggers in your niche.

* Look at the competitors - Analyze the backlinks of your competition and see where they published their guest posts. Then, follow their lead — and like them, approach the owners of websites where they submitted guest posts and inquire about guest blogging opportunities.

Pitch Your Ideas

Tailor your pitch to the specific website and audience. Perform due diligence to understand what content they are interested in and the gaps you can fill with your guest post.

Better yet, see if the website has a section that features guest post guidelines. If it has, stick to these regulations when writing guest posts.

Additionally, consider the following points when crafting your guest post idea:

* Show your interest in the website and its mission - Explain how your guest post will align with the mission and values of the website. Also, inform them how it will contribute to their overall content strategy.

* Be professional - Proofread your pitch and double-check for any errors or inconsistencies. Use a formal tone and address the website owner or editor by name if possible.

* Be respectful of their time - Keep your pitch concise and to the point, and respect their time by not following up too frequently if you haven't received a response yet.

Below is an email pitch template you can use.

Hey [Name],

I'm a big fan of [Blog Name] and the valuable information and insights you provide to your readers. I'm excited to pitch an article idea that I believe would be a great fit for your audience.

The article I'm proposing is titled "[Proposed article title]" and it will explore [summary of the article]. My goal is to provide [website audience] with [what the article will provide].

I'm already writing regularly for [Blog name 1], [Blog name 2], and [Blog name 3], and I believe my expertise in [expertise] would make me a great fit for your website. Here are a few of my latest posts:

[Blog post link 1]

[Blog post link 2]

[Blog post link 3]

Please let me know if you are interested, and I'll be happy to send you some more detailed topic ideas.



Write High-Quality Guest Posts That Will Be Accepted

Once the host approves your pitch, be ready to start writing your guest post. From here, be sure you produce nothing but high-quality content.

Below are some tips to keep in mind while writing your guest post.

* Make sure the article is a good fit - Align the content with the mission and audience of the host website.

* Use anchor text for links wisely - Be strategic with your anchor text. Avoid keyword stuffing and ensure that the link text accurately describes the content of the link destination.

* Keep the subject matter topically relevant to the website content - Maintain continuity for the readers and ensure that the linked pages are relevant to the article's content and themes.

Additionally, create backlinks for posts — think of alternative link building methods. It enhances the PageRank of the article — leading to a boost in the link equity passed to the website through the contextual links.

Follow Up With Blog Editor

Following up on guest post pitches can be a delicate task. As part of your guest blogging strategy, you should ensure that you communicate well with the potential host — without annoying them.

A tip is to get straight to the point and keep your message short. Don't add unnecessary information (or repeat information).  

Below are more tips to help you with this process.

* Respect the host's timeline - It's important to remember that everyone has their schedule and priorities. You can send a follow-up message if the host hasn't responded to your initial pitch within a reasonable time frame.

* Personalize your follow-up - When following up, make sure to personalize your message. Show that you have taken the time to read the host's website or blog and that you have a genuine interest in contributing to their platform.

* Show your flexibility - If the host expresses any concerns or issues, be flexible and willing to address them. Show that you want to work with them to make your guest post a good fit for their platform.

Promote Your Published Guest Post

Promoting guest blog posts can benefit the guest blogger and the host website owner. If you don’t promote your post, nobody will know it exists (unless you have a loyal following).

Below are tips to help promote your published guest post.

* Post on online communities (like forums and Facebook groups) - Search for the B2B Bloggers Boost Group on Facebook to find other bloggers open to cross-linking with your sites on their guest posts. In exchange, they will want to get links back to their website from your guest blogging opportunities. You can also answer questions on Q&A sites and inform the audience about your guest post.

* Promote guest posts on social media - Run social media campaigns to promote the guest post. For example, you can boost a guest blog post on Facebook or run a promoted tweet on Twitter.

* Leverage SEO to boost visibility - Follow SEO tips to optimize your guest post for search engines. You can include relevant keywords in the post title, body, and meta tags. Also, you can feature the guest post on your homepage or (on the top navigation) for better visibility.


Are you still wondering why guest blogging is so effective?

It’s because it comes with an advantage that may not be immediately obvious: professional networking, collaboration opportunities, audience expansion, and more!

When you post on someone else's site, you can connect with the site's owner, audience, and other guest bloggers.

Guest posting is also a great way to learn from other writers and editors. It can also provide an opportunity to develop new skills and improve your writing style.

Plus, by reading and interacting with other bloggers and industry experts, you may be exposed to new ideas and perspectives that can help you to improve your content and approach.

About the Author


Reviews   (47)

I provide COMPREHENSIVE CONTENT EXPERIENCES designed to improve my clients' online visibility by observing the best on-page SEO practices and engaging their audience with well-written and informative content.

+ See more